Multiple myeloma is a complex form of blood cancer that originates from abnormal plasma cells within the bone marrow. These plasma cells, which normally play a critical role in the immune system by producing antibodies to combat infections, become malignant in this disease, leading to their uncontrolled proliferation. As they multiply, these cancerous cells form tumors that can damage bones, suppress normal blood cell production, and impair immune function. Understanding this disease requires an exploration of its underlying causes, risk factors, early detection methods, and strategies for prevention and management.


At present, the precise cause of multiple myeloma remains elusive. However, extensive research suggests that genetic mutations and chromosomal abnormalities in plasma cells might set the stage for malignant transformation. Certain genetic markers and inherited predispositions could also influence susceptibility. While environmental exposures are under investigation, factors such as radiation, exposure to specific chemicals, and lifestyle choices are believed to contribute to the risk profile.

Multiple myeloma predominantly affects older adults, with the median age at diagnosis around the mid-60s. It has been observed more frequently in men than women and shows higher prevalence among certain ethnic groups, particularly African Americans. These variations highlight the importance of considering geographical and genetic factors in understanding disease risk.

Symptoms of multiple myeloma often develop gradually, making early detection challenging. Common signs include persistent bone pain, especially in the back or ribs, fatigue, weakness, anemia, susceptibility to infections, and unexplained weight loss. Elevated calcium levels, kidney dysfunction, and fractures may also indicate disease progression and require prompt medical evaluation.

Risk Factors for Multiple Myeloma

Age: The risk increases significantly with age, particularly after 60 years.

Family History: A history of multiple myeloma or other plasma cell disorders in family members elevates risk.

Race and Ethnicity: African Americans have a higher incidence, possibly linked to genetic factors.

Obesity: Excess body weight is associated with increased risk due to inflammatory processes and hormonal influences.

Radiation and Chemical Exposure: Exposure to high levels of radiation and certain chemicals may contribute to disease development.

Other Medical Conditions: Conditions like monoclonal gammopathy of undetermined significance (MGUS) can be precursors to multiple myeloma.

Prevention Strategies and Lifestyle Tips

While specific prevention methods are limited due to the complex nature of the disease, adopting healthy lifestyle habits can help reduce overall risk. Regular health screenings and blood tests can assist in early detection, especially in high-risk populations.

Maintaining a nutritious, balanced diet rich in vegetables, fruits, and lean proteins supports immune health and reduces chronic inflammation. It is advisable to limit processed foods, sugar intake, excessive alcohol consumption, and smoking, as these factors can negatively impact overall health and immune function.

Engaging in regular physical activity, managing weight effectively, and avoiding unnecessary exposure to radiation or hazardous chemicals are proactive steps toward lowering risk. For individuals with a family history or other risk factors, consulting healthcare professionals for personalized screening plans can be highly beneficial.

Advances in Treatment and Management

Over the past decades, significant progress has been made in the treatment of multiple myeloma. Innovative therapies such as targeted drugs, immunotherapy, and stem cell transplants have improved survival rates and quality of life. Early diagnosis combined with personalized treatment plans can effectively manage symptoms and slow disease progression.

Patients are encouraged to work closely with their healthcare team to monitor disease status, manage side effects, and explore clinical trials. Supportive care measures, including pain management and bone health support, are essential components of comprehensive care for multiple myeloma patients.
